Accountant

Position Purpose

The accountant will be responsible for all daily financial transactions, such as data entries, payments, bank reconciliations etc. to ensure smooth implementation of all projects and APLA financial transactions according to the accounting financial standards, APLA laws and rules, and Palestinian related laws.

Key Responsibilities

  1. Record and maintain all financial transactions in the Bisan accounting system, ensuring accuracy and completeness.

  2. Review project payment requests for accuracy, completeness, and compliance, and submit them to the Finance and Administration Manager for approval.

  3. Prepare payment requests for organizational and project-related expenses in line with approved procedures.

  4. Process payments (bank transfers and checks) and follow up with banks to ensure timely execution.

  5. Maintain proper filing and archiving of all financial records and supporting documents (physical and electronic).

  6. Prepare monthly financial reports and summaries for review by the Finance and Administration Manager.

  7. Perform monthly bank reconciliations and ensure proper resolution of discrepancies.

  8. Monitor, review, and reconcile petty cash transactions in accordance with financial policies.

  9. Support procurement processes by ensuring financial compliance and proper documentation, as requested.

  10. Assist in the preparation of periodic financial reports, budgets, and financial statements.

  11. Support internal and external audit processes by preparing required documentation and responding to audit queries.

  12. Track and update LGU and Village Council (VC) membership financial data within the Bisan system.

  13. Ensure compliance with organizational financial policies, procedures, and donor requirements.

  14. Perform any other finance-related tasks as assigned by the Finance and Administration Manager.
